I have a part of my route where I go a half mile down a parallel street to avoid the street AND sidewalk on this piece of particular road. Road has very narrow lanes and has ALOT of semi traffic. The sidewalk is driveway riddled and not the nicest surface.

I have another part of my route where I use the sidewalk to go over a bridge and through an underpass that is an entry/exit to an interstate. This area is always backed up, narrow lanes and semi riddled. Needless to say, I'm VERY careful, VERY aware of my surroundings, make sure that I'm seen by motorists and expect the unexpected.
